Background

NENA = North American Emergency Number  Association

Sets standards (among many other things) for emergency calls in U.S./Canada

Next Generation 9-1-1 project ± Complete overhaul of the entire 9-1-1 system

 ± Based on IP ± Includes changes to processes, funding, training, etc, etc

 ± The initial version of the technical standards part is knownas ³i3´

i3 is based on IETF Emergency CallMechanisms

Endpoint (phone) ³determines´ its location by measurement(e.g. GPS) or from the access network via a ³Location

Configuration Protocol´ Endpoint ³maps´ the location to the URI of the PSAP with a new

protocol, LoST

Endpoint learns LOCAL dialstring (9-1-1, 1-1-2) from LoST

Endpoint recognizes emergency call dialstring when dialed

Call is marked with service urn (urn:service:sos) Call is sent to PSAP with mapped URI

Location is ³conveyed´ with the call

Call arrives at PSAP with location and call back info

Works for all media (voice, video, text, IM, «)

Location Configuration Protocols

How the access network provides location

Exchange an identifier of some kind, implicitly (e.g. what port on

the switch) or explicitly (e.g. MAC address, IP address) for location

Location can be civic or geo

Current discussion on whether it can be a reference (e.g. URI)which must be dereferenced by some other protocol, or must

be a value DHCP is an example LCP

There is a ³Layer 7´ LCP in development

LLDP-MED is another example of an LCP

Marking an Emergency Call

Single global standard to denote an emergency call(does not rely on local dialstrings)

Uses a newly defined Service urn Local dialstring is detected, and call is then marked

with the service urn

Single number countries (9-1-1) use urn:service:sos

Number-per-service countries (1-1-6=police) use e.g.urn:service:sos.police

Extends to commercial location based routing, e.g.urn:service:restaurant.pizza.pizzahut)

Normally endpoint does dialstring to service URNtranslation, network can do it

Routing Emergency Calls

Location to Service Translation = LoST

Service URN + Location in, URI out

 A ³Mapping´ function

 Accepts civic/geo and service urn, returns URI, e.g.SIP and/or XMPP URI of where to route the call

Normal (SIP) routing of that URI

LoST is global, distributed, and replicated Normally endpoint maps, network can do it

LoST will also supply the dialstring(s) for a location

LoST will also validate a civic location

Back to NENA i3

 All calls answered as IP calls at PSAP

Implies gateways between older TDMswitches and PSAPs

 All calls routed with LoST

Implies TN to location lookup prior to routing  All calls arrive at PSAP with location and call

back address (can be URI or e.164)

Emergency Services IP Network

 An IP network FOR ALL OF PUBLIC SAFETY, not just 9-1-1

 A regular routed IP network DOES have (firewalled) connections to the Internet

Conceived as LOCAL networks (e.g. County level)interconnected with neighbors, perhaps a backbonefor efficiency

Most local carriers will have private connections tothe local ESInet

Option of using the Internet to introduce calls

Multi-Stage Routing

Emergency Services Routing Proxies at edge

of ESInet onward route calls to PSAP Uses LoST with authentication

User LoST query may return URI of ESRP

ESRP will foreward to PSAP Could have more than one level of ESRP

More Data will be accepted

 Additional Information about the call ± Includes carrier contact info, subscriber class of service, etc

 ±

Call marked with URI of a datastructure to be retrieved by the PSAP ±  Also used for pointer to telematics data

 Additional Information about the caller  ± Refers to the person, independent of home/office/mobile telephone

 ± Could be medical info, ³in emergency, please contact´, «)

 ±  Also a URI (anonymous), supplied by subscriber to carrier 

 Additional Information about the location

 ± Comes from LoST ± Two calls from same location will have same info, regardless of caller or 

carrier 

 ± Could be floor plans, hazardous materials, surveillance video, «

i3 PSAPs will be multimedia

Voice, Video, Text

Will support a variety of codecs (but not all of them,carriers don¶t decide)

Will support both IM and interactive (character at atime codecs)

Full Offer/Answer negotiation

Will use codec choice to automatically engage relayoperators if needed

Will use Language preference info to route calls toappropriate call takers, and automatically engageinterpreters

3rd Party Calls

Used when user contacts a call center first

 ± Text/Video/IP Relay ± Telematics (OnStar)

 ± Central Alarm Monitoring

 Authorized 3rd parties can directly introduce

calls, routed by location of user, with all 3parties conferenced at the PSAP

PSAPs use LoST to route toresponders

 A PSAP will make LoST dips with caller¶s

location to determine the responding police,fire, ems, « services

 A different service urn

Requires authentication

Same underlying database This replaces the ³ESN´ of the current

system

Notes to endpoint vendors

Read ±phonebcp (will be draft-ietf-ecrit-phonebcp-00)

Implement ALL OF a short list of LCPs

Map location to PSAP URI and cache it

Recognize local (and maybe home) dialstrings as emergencycalls

Mark emergency calls with service URN

Try to update location and LoST mapping at call time, use

cached values if needed Several other SIP things to support PSAP operations on calls

Support manual override of determined location, but make itpossible, not easy to use

Notes to Access Network Providers

Need to choose one of the LCPs the phones willimplement and deploy it

The only way to choose something not on the ±phonebcp list is to force every endpoint to dosomething else ± But watch out for Ethernet connected phones behind a

router/switch with an uplink to your network; you may not beable to control them

Probably will be asked to supply a hint to a localLoST service

Validate (use LoST) civic locations when you putthem in your location server

Notes to Communications (e.g. VoIP)

Carriers

Prepare to route marked emergency calls to

PSAP/ESRP Prioritize marked emergency calls in softswitches

Deploy connections to local ESInets

 Add the ³Info about the call´ URI with your contact

data, etc. Support Interactive Text & Video codecs all the way

through the system for the disabled
